RTC Methodendefinition
An dieser Stelle erfolgt das Kopieren der Funktionen aus der main-Datei, außer printTime() in main wird ersetzt durch den Code aus der Funktion printTime():
//
// @ Project : RTC Date Time Clock
// @ File Name : RTC8563.cpp
// @ Date : 06.04.2015
// @ Author : Franz Pucher
// @ Copyright : pe@bulme.at
//
#include "mbed.h"
#include "const.h"
#include "RTC8563.h"
RTC8563::RTC8563() : i2c(p28, p27) // delete void and add call to base constructor
{
// Initialise I2C
i2c.frequency(40000);
char init1[2] = {0x6, 0x00};
char init2[2] = {0x7, 0xff};
i2c.write(0x40, init1, 2);
i2c.write(0x40, init2, 2);
}
RTC8563::RTC8563(PinName sda, PinName scl) : i2c(sda, scl)
{
// Initialise I2C
i2c.frequency(40000);
char init1[2] = {0x6, 0x00};
char init2[2] = {0x7, 0xff};
i2c.write(0x40, init1, 2);
i2c.write(0x40, init2, 2);
}
char RTC8563::rtc_read(char address)
{
char value;
i2c.start();
i2c.write(RTC8563_ADR);
i2c.write(address);
i2c.start();
i2c.write(RTC8563_ADR | _READ);
value = i2c.read(0);
i2c.stop();
return value;
}
void RTC8563::rtc_write(char address, char value)
{
i2c.start();
i2c.write(RTC8563_ADR);
i2c.write(address);
i2c.write(value);
i2c.stop();
}
void RTC8563::rtc_init()
{
}
void RTC8563::rtc_alarm()
{
}
Die Main-Funktion hat somit folgendes aussehen:
#include "mbed.h"
#include "const.h"
#include "RTC8563.h"
#include "string"
Serial pc(USBTX, USBRX);
//I2C i2c(p28, p27);
uint8_t year, month, day, week;
uint8_t hour, minute, sec;
char week_chr[7][4] = {"MON","TUE","WED","THU","FRI","SAT","SUN"};
int main()
{
RTC8563 rtc; // instanziieren des Objektes rtc
pc.printf("Setting up RTC\n");
//rtc.rtc_init();
while(1) {
//printTime();
year = rtc.rtc_read(YEARS); // Aufruf der Methode rtc_read der Instanz (Objekt) rtc
month = rtc.rtc_read(MONTHS);
day = rtc.rtc_read(DAYS);
week = rtc.rtc_read(WEEKDAYS);
hour = rtc.rtc_read(HOURS);
minute = rtc.rtc_read(MINUTES);
sec = rtc.rtc_read(SECONDS);
//Datum Ausgabe
pc.printf("20%x%x/%x%x/%x%x %s\n",
((year >> 4) & 0x03) , (year & 0x0F) ,
((month >> 4) & 0x01), (month & 0x0F) ,
((day >> 4) & 0x03), (day & 0x0F) ,
week_chr[week & 0x07]);
//Zeit Ausgabe
pc.printf("%x%x:%x%x:%x%x\n",
((hour >> 4) & 0x03), (hour & 0x0F),
(minute >> 4), (minute & 0x0F) ,
(sec >> 4), (sec & 0x0F) );
wait(1);
}
}
Teste das Programm mit HIMBED M0 Board.
